IBM DS3512 error "Host wide port is degraded"

I am getting an error."Host wide port is degraded" in the IBM DS3512 storage. It is connected to IBM blade center H using the SAS switch. the port connected to the SAN sas switch  and the storage port showing orange color.

I would suspect the cable, a SAS wide port is made from bundling together several single lanes - there are 4 lanes in the cable and normally all 4 are bundled into a single wide port, sounds like you have one or more lanes missing.  If you have two switches and dual domain I would reseat the cable both ends after checking (under MPIO, etc) that each host sees both connections.
